How Social Stress Expands Its Territory
Untreated social anxiousness follows a predictable sample of encroachment into ever more broader regions of lifestyle. What commences as distress throughout significant gatherings slowly extends to smaller sized social circles. Stress and anxiety about community Talking expands to dread of speaking in crew conferences. Problem about indicating the "Mistaken factor" to strangers evolves into checking each phrase with close family and friends.
Your Mind, constantly bolstered by avoidance behaviors, gets to be hypersensitive to probable social threats—perceived judgment, criticism, or rejection. Physical signs or symptoms intensify with Every publicity: the racing coronary heart, excessive sweating, trembling voice, racing views, and overpowering urge to flee. These physiological responses further more reinforce the belief that social conditions are truly threatening.
Numerous sufferers explain this development as viewing their entire world steadily deal—declining career chances that contain presentation or networking, limiting relationships to only by far the most comfortable interactions, and at some point suffering from loneliness In spite of their initiatives to stay away from social discomfort. The isolation intended as safety gets its individual method of struggling.

How Scientific Psychologists Exclusively Deal with Social Anxiety
Scientific psychologists carry specialized abilities to social nervousness therapy that differs noticeably from normal supportive counseling. Making use of proof-based mostly approaches precisely designed for social anxiety dysfunction, they help dismantle the elaborate architecture of ideas, inner thoughts, and behaviors preserving your social discomfort.
Treatment method usually starts with a thorough assessment within your certain social stress and anxiety patterns. Which predicaments set off quite possibly the most extreme reactions? What feelings immediately occur? What avoidance behaviors have become habitual? This in depth being familiar with permits your psychologist to produce a treatment program exactly personalized to your needs.
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), notably helpful for social anxiousness, will help you detect and challenge the distorted pondering designs fueling your social fears. These are not simply just irrational thoughts for being dismissed but deeply ingrained beliefs that call for systematic restructuring. Your psychologist will guideline you thru recognizing assumptions like thoughts-looking through ("Anyone can tell I'm anxious"), catastrophizing ("I'll totally freeze up"), and personalizing ("They're all judging me negatively").
Graduated exposure therapy—very carefully intended to Make social assurance incrementally—allows you to practice more and more tough social scenarios in a supportive therapeutic framework. Not like properly-that means tips to "just place oneself around," this structured strategy assures Each and every stage builds upon previous successes, gradually growing your comfort and ease zone devoid of frustrating your coping assets.
Social abilities coaching may be included when panic has constrained possibilities to develop snug conversation patterns. These usually are not artificial scripts but practical procedures for navigating conversations, handling silences, and expressing you authentically.
